Cairns Fire Helmet Maintenance and Repair

Keeping your Cairns fire helmet in top condition is vital. Regular servicing ensures it provides the highest level of security for firefighters on the job. Check your helmet regularly for signs of damage, such as cracks in the exterior. A damaged helmet can compromise your well-being.

  • Guarantee your helmet sits properly. A good fit is necessary for stability during operations.
  • Scrub the helmet regularly with a wet rag. Avoid using harsh substances.
  • Swap damaged parts promptly. This includes the clear cover, straps, and padding.

If you're doubtful about any aspect of your helmet's state, reach out a qualified professional for suggestions. Remember, your fire helmet is your first line of defense – treat it with respect!
